I had a great workout tonight! My shoulder didn't bother me at all until the very end when I started doing hammer curls. Even then it was not too bad, but right now I've got it iced down and it's hurting a bit more than it was in the weight room. I think endorphins mask some of the discomfort, and that's something I need to be cognizant of if I want to avoid making it worse. It's so hard for me to come down once I get going. I consider that a positive trait, as long as I'm not injured!

Here was tonight's workout:

BICEPS/TRICEPS (SUPERSETS)
4x10 Machine preacher curls/4x10 Tricep cable push-downs
4x10 Ez-bar curls/4x10 Standing Ez-bar french curls
4x8 DB hammer curls/4x10 Standing DB tricep extensions

Workout took about 40 minutes.

So that workout completes one full week of bulking. I'll be doing the same exercises I've been posting to this journal over the past week (increasing weights, of course) for the next 2 or 3 weeks. I'll post new routines when I switch things up.

Thanks for the flattering words of encouragement!

I think several things have contributed to my good start: First, I've resumed taking creatine after almost 3 months of being off of it. I'm taking a couple of different kinds of creatine: CEE & Malate (I like BSN's NO-Xplode & CellMass). I've also been eating a lot of carbs. Of course I'm busing my butt in the gym and giving 110% effort in all my workouts. Additionally I'm eating clean, I'm getting plenty of rest and I try to maintain a positive attitude at all times (that really helps!) With the exception of the creatine, all those things I listed above are essential to bulking success. Unfortunately a lot of people who try to bulk only do a fraction of what's required to make good gains and, as a result, they gain nothing but fat and frustration. You know my philosophy: If you are going to do something, give it your all (and then a little more!)

I've gained 4.8 pounds in just 6 days, but of course very little, if any, of that weight is muscle. I have to fight for every ounce of muscle just like everyone else! Stay tuned, the real gains are coming...
